Role Summary
The Day Cleaner is responsible for maintaining cleanliness and hygiene standards across the production facility throughout operational hours. This role supports food safety compliance by ensuring production areas, staff facilities, and common areas remain clean, organised, and free from contamination risks.
Key Responsibilities
· Clean and sanitise designated production areas during operational hours
· Maintain cleanliness of floors, surfaces, and equipment exteriors
· Remove waste and maintain waste disposal areas
· Clean staff welfare areas including break rooms, changing rooms, and toilets
· Refill hygiene stations including hand wash, sanitiser, and paper products
· Respond to cleaning requests from production teams
· Follow all hygiene protocols relating to raw pet food production
· Safely handle cleaning chemicals according to company procedures
· Maintain cleaning logs and checklists where required
